Ingredients

  • 400 g (14 oz) thin spaghetti
  • Salt, for pasta water
  • 200 g (7 oz) fresh baby spinach
  • 2 cloves garlic, finely minced
  • Zest of 1 lemon
  • Juice of 1 large lemon
  • 2 tbsp unsalted butter
  • 200 ml (3/4 cup + 1 tbsp) heavy cream
  • 60 g (1/2 cup) grated Parmesan cheese
  • Freshly ground black pepper, to taste
  • Extra lemon zest (for garnish)
  • Additional Parmesan (for garnish)

Instructions

Step 1
Bring a large pot of salted water to a boil. Cook the spaghetti according to package instructions until al dente. Reserve 120 ml (1/2 cup) of pasta water, then drain.
Step 2
While the pasta cooks, heat the butter in a large skillet over medium heat. Add the garlic and cook for 1 minute until fragrant, but not browned.
Step 3
Add the spinach and sauté for 2–3 minutes until wilted. Stir in the lemon zest.
Step 4
Pour in the heavy cream and bring to a gentle simmer. Stir in the lemon juice and Parmesan cheese, letting the cheese melt and the sauce thicken slightly.
Step 5
Add the drained spaghetti to the skillet, tossing to coat in the sauce. If needed, gradually add reserved pasta water to achieve a silky, creamy consistency.
Step 6
Season generously with black pepper and adjust salt to taste.
Step 7
Serve immediately, garnished with extra lemon zest and additional Parmesan.

Zusatztipps für die Zubereitung

To ensure a perfect sauce, use a microplane to create a very fine lemon zest that integrates seamlessly into the cream. Always remember to reserve the pasta water before draining; its starch content is the secret to achieving that professional, silky consistency in the final skillet toss.

Varianten und Anpassungen

This recipe is highly versatile. You can substitute the spaghetti with whole wheat or gluten-free pasta if desired. For those who enjoy a bit of heat, a pinch of red pepper flakes added with the garlic works wonders. If you are looking to increase the protein, this dish pairs beautifully with grilled chicken or sautéed shrimp.

Serviervorschläge

Serve this pasta immediately while warm to enjoy the sauce at its best. It pairs exceptionally well with a crisp white wine, such as Sauvignon Blanc or Pinot Grigio, which complements the bright acidity of the lemon. Finish each plate with a fresh grating of Parmesan and an extra pinch of zest.

Recipe Questions & Answers

Can I make this dish ahead of time?

This pasta is best served immediately while the sauce is creamy and glossy. If you need to prepare ahead, undercook the pasta slightly and store separately from the sauce. Reheat gently with a splash of cream or pasta water to restore consistency before serving.

What can I substitute for heavy cream?

Half-and-half works for a lighter version, though the sauce will be less rich. For dairy-free options, coconut cream creates a similarly thick texture with subtle coconut flavor. Cashew cream is another excellent alternative that maintains luxurious mouthfeel.

How do I prevent the sauce from separating?

Keep heat at medium-low once cream is added and avoid boiling vigorously. Stir continuously when incorporating Parmesan. The key is gentle heat and constant movement. If sauce does separate, whisk vigorously off-heat while adding small amounts of pasta water.

Can I use other types of pasta?

Absolutely. Fettuccine, linguine, or angel hair work beautifully with this sauce. Short pasta like penne or fusilli captures the sauce in different ways. Just adjust cooking time according to package instructions and reserve pasta water before draining.

How do I store and reheat leftovers?

Store in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. Reheat gently in a skillet over low heat, adding small splashes of cream or pasta water to loosen the sauce. Avoid microwave reheating as it can cause the cream to separate and become grainy.

Is this dish freezer-friendly?

Unfortunately, cream-based sauces don't freeze well as they can separate and become grainy upon thawing. The pasta also tends to become mushy. For best results, enjoy freshly made or refrigerate for 2-3 days maximum.
